The Gilera Dakota is a model of motorbike known for its versatility and performance, often utilized for both on-road commuting and light off-road excursions. These motorcycles are characterized by their robust construction, capable suspension systems, and reliable engine performance, making them suitable for a wide range of riding conditions and purposes. Their design prioritizes a balance of agility and stability, catering to riders who demand a dependable and engaging riding experience.
